prospective
/prəʊˈspektɪv/adjective
attrib.
1- (of a person) expected or expecting to be something particular in the future(人)预期的, 盼望中的:
she showed a prospective buyer around the house.
她领着可能成为买主的人看房子。
1.1
- likely to happen at a future date; concerned with or applying to the future未来可能发生的; 未来的:
a meeting to discuss prospective changes in government legislation.
讨论政府立法未来可能发生变化的会议。

late 16th cent. (in the sense 'looking forward,having foresight'): from obsolete French prospectif,-ive or late Latin prospectivus,from Latin prospectus 'view' (see PROSPECT).
